Unload Sequencing Consumables
If used sequencing consumables are present when you are setting up a scan, the software prompts you to unload the reagent cartridge and buffer cartridge before proceeding to the next step.
|
1.
|
If prompted, remove used sequencing consumables from a previous sequencing run. |
|
a.
|
Remove the reagent cartridge from the reagent compartment. Dispose of unused contents in accordance with applicable standards. |
|
b.
|
Remove the used buffer cartridge from the buffer compartment. |
This set of reagents contains potentially hazardous chemicals. Personal injury can occur through inhalation, ingestion, skin contact, and eye contact. Ventilation should be appropriate for handling of hazardous materials in reagents. Wear protective equipment, including eye protection, gloves, and laboratory coat appropriate for risk of exposure. Handle used reagents as chemical waste and discard in accordance with applicable regional, national, and local laws and regulations. For additional environmental, health, and safety information, refer to the SDS at support.illumina.com/sds.html.
|
2.
|
Close the reagent compartment and buffer compartment doors. |
